To clarify, the 'Internship' forum is for medical Interns. interns are doctors who just graduated from medical school last year and are now in their first year of extremely formalized on the job training. You want to post this kind of question in the 'pre-allopathic' forum, which is for college students who are trying to get into medical school.

And to answer your question: if he ends up with a publication in exchange for ony one year of working 8 hours a week I would say that qualifies as a good time investment. You're right that something more medical might be viewed in a marginally better light, but I think this is a situation where the perfect might be an enemy of the good.
